#5ca408 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5ca408 is composed of 36.1% red, 64.3%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.1%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 87.7 degrees, a saturation of 90.7% and a lightness of 33.7%. #5ca408 color hex could be obtained by blending #b8ff10 with #004900.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

Shades and Tints of #5ca408
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080e01 is the darkest color, while #fdfffb is the lightest one.
